"Jamie Foxx Denies Sexual Assault Allegations Made by Woman at New York Bar"

TL;DR Summary
A woman, known as Jane Doe, has filed a lawsuit alleging that actor Jamie Foxx sexually assaulted her at a rooftop bar in New York in 2015. The lawsuit claims that Foxx rubbed her breasts, groped her under her pants, and touched her genitals without her consent. Foxx's representative denies the allegations, stating that a similar lawsuit was previously dismissed in 2020 and intends to pursue a claim for malicious prosecution. The lawsuit was filed under the temporary New York law, the Adult Survivors Act, which allows adult victims to sue over alleged sexual attacks that were previously outside the statute of limitations.
